Night Out in the Parks: Big Table Dinner

Logos

Join us for an evening of food and conversation to celebrate the amazing urban agriculture that is happening all over Chicago. The Big Table Dinner is farm-to-table style dinner that features local restaurants and food growers. The dinner is hosted by the Green City Market Junior Board in partnership with Chicago Park District’s Night Out in the Parks and designed to bring together farmers, producers, chefs, agricultural activists, community leaders, local business owners, food lovers, neighbors, and more to share a free meal in the park.

What’s on the menu?

Enjoy a thoughtfully-prepared meal while participating in conversations facilitated by local agriculture and culinary leaders. The menu will feature a rainbow of fresh, seasonal produce from local farmers and community gardens. The dishes for the Big Table Dinner are being generously cooked by local chefs.
